Hello, I am trying to configure several of the not-yet configured Fn keys on my Netbook, and I need some help with one right now. I want to disable the touchpad (mouse) functionality, including buttons and all completely when I hit Fn+F3.
I want to disable it in the kernel level (or userspace level) but not with Xorg only. For example, I also use gpm with my ttys, so I also want it disabled there. Well, finally I should mention that the Fn key should be a toggle button. So once I press Fn+F3 after it's disabled, I want it to toggle back to enabled. The Fn has no software keycode on it's own, it's hard-coded, so when I used showkey -s the output was only keycode 191. Any suggestions? What utils should I use?
